The specialized outpatient curative care expenditure in Belgium as a percentage of GDP from 2024 to 2028 is forecasted to remain steady at 0.29%. This indicates no change in the share of GDP allocated to this sector for these years. In 2023, the expenditure also stood at 0.29% of GDP.
Variations:
- Year-on-year variation from 2023 to 2024: 0%
- Year-on-year variation from 2024 to 2025: 0%
- Year-on-year variation from 2025 to 2026: 0%
- Year-on-year variation from 2026 to 2027: 0%
- Year-on-year variation from 2027 to 2028: 0%
- Last two years variation: 0%
- Last five years CAGR: 0%
This consistent allocation indicates stability, suggesting that the expenditure on specialized outpatient curative care as a proportion of GDP is not anticipated to change significantly within the forecasted period.
Future trends to watch for include potential shifts in government healthcare policies, technological advancements in outpatient care, demographic changes such as aging population, and economic fluctuations which could impact healthcare funding and expenditure.
